90 locals recommend
Zanzabar
2100 S Preston St
90 locals recommend
Former dive turned hipster happenin' spot. If you go early, you can enjoy bar food and beers. If you go late, you're at one of the hottest dance floors in town. On some nights, it functions as a regionally high profile indie music venue.

Parks & Nature

Large, urban park with walking trails and a golf course. Designed by the same landscape architect who designed New York City's Central Park. http://www.olmstedparks.org/our-parks/cherokee-park/
383 locals recommend
Cherokee Park
745 Cochran Hill Rd
383 locals recommend
Large, urban park with walking trails and a golf course. Designed by the same landscape architect who designed New York City's Central Park. http://www.olmstedparks.org/our-parks/cherokee-park/
